What is an assistant pipeline inspector?

Career: Assistant Pipeline Inspector

Assistant Pipeline Inspectors are entry-level professionals who support senior inspectors in monitoring, assessing, and maintaining pipelines used to transport oil, gas, or other substances. Their duties typically include helping conduct safety inspections, recording data, assisting with leak detection, and ensuring compliance with regulations. They work under the supervision of experienced inspectors and often travel to various sites to perform their tasks. This role provides valuable hands-on experience for those seeking to advance in the pipeline inspection field.
